Description

Parametric insurance, index-based insurance, crop insurance, catastrophe bonds, and other climate risk transfer products. These instruments protect against climate-related losses (drought, flooding, hurricanes) and improve financial resilience of vulnerable populations. Colombia faces high physical climate risk exposure, making climate insurance a strategic adaptation tool.

Colombia Context

Fasecolda (Federación de Aseguradores Colombianos) coordinates the insurance sector's response to climate risk. The Seguro Agropecuario (agricultural insurance) program, subsidized by Finagro, covers crop losses from climate events — approximately 15% of agricultural area is currently insured. Parametric insurance pilots have been implemented in the Caribe for hurricane risk (Swiss Re partnership) and in the Andean region for drought (Munich Re, GIZ). The CCRIF SPC (Caribbean Catastrophe Risk Insurance Facility) model is being studied for Colombia's Pacific and Caribbean coasts. SFC Circular 028 requires insurers to assess climate-related underwriting risks. Fasecolda's Agenda de Sostenibilidad includes climate risk modelling capacity building. The UNGRD (Unidad Nacional para la Gestión del Riesgo de Desastres) estimates annual disaster losses at $1.2 billion, of which less than 30% is insured. IDB Lab's InsurTech program supports digital climate insurance distribution in rural Colombia. MinAgricultura's Programa de Cobertura targets expanding agricultural insurance to 30% of cultivated area by 2030.

Green Finance Alignment

Partial TVC alignment — insurance is not a primary TVC category but climate risk transfer supports adaptation finance. The InsuResilience Global Partnership (of which Colombia is a member) targets 500 million additional people covered by climate risk insurance by 2025. IDB's Climate Risk Insurance Initiative provides technical assistance to Colombian insurers for parametric product development.
